The Critical Role of Physical Therapy Equipment
Before addressing logistical issues, it’s essential to understand the diverse range of equipment used in physical therapy. Beyond traditional weights and resistance bands, the field incorporates:
- Electrotherapy Devices: Used for pain management, muscle stimulation, and tissue healing (e.g., TENS units, ultrasound machines).
- Therapeutic Modalities: Heat packs, ice packs, and other tools for reducing inflammation and pain.
- Gait Training Equipment: Treadmills, parallel bars, walkers, and orthotics to aid mobility and balance.
- Strength Training Equipment: Resistance machines, free weights, and specialized tools for building muscle strength.
- Balance and Coordination Devices: Wobble boards, balance beams, and other tools to improve stability.
- Assistive Devices: Braces, splints, and supports to provide stability and aid function.
- Specialized Equipment: For conditions like neurological rehabilitation (e.g., Bioness systems) or pediatric therapy.
The effectiveness of physical therapy often depends on equipment tailored to individual patient needs. Delays in receiving this equipment can disrupt treatment, interrupt progress, and prolong recovery timelines.

The Hidden Threat: Temperature Sensitivity & Equipment Degradation
While shipping delays are frustrating, a less-discussed issue is the potential for equipment degradation due to improper temperature control during transit. Many physical therapy devices, particularly those with electronics or sensitive materials, are vulnerable to damage from extreme temperatures and humidity.
- Electronics: Exposure to high heat can damage circuit boards, batteries, and other components, leading to malfunctions.
- Plastics & Polymers: Extreme temperatures can cause warping, cracking, or brittleness, compromising structural integrity.
- Batteries: High temperatures can reduce battery life and even cause leaks or explosions.
- Lubricants & Fluids: Temperature fluctuations can affect viscosity and performance.
- Sterility Concerns: For equipment requiring sterilization, temperature excursions can compromise sterility.

The Solution: Temperature-Controlled Shipping – A Game Changer for Physical Therapy Practices
The key to mitigating both shipping delays and equipment degradation lies in implementing temperature-controlled shipping solutions. This involves:
- Validated Packaging: Utilizing insulated containers, phase change materials (PCMs), and other specialized packaging to maintain a stable temperature range.
- Temperature Monitoring: Employing real-time temperature monitoring devices (data loggers) to track conditions throughout the shipping process.
- Qualified Carriers: Partnering with shipping carriers experienced in handling temperature-sensitive healthcare equipment.
- Chain of Custody Tracking: Ensuring accountability and preventing mishandling with clear tracking throughout the shipping process.
- Proactive Risk Management: Identifying potential temperature risks and implementing mitigation strategies.
- Compliance with Regulations: Adhering to guidelines for shipping temperature-sensitive medical devices.
